A student is studying the boiling points of six different liquids and finds results with consistently higher boiling points than what research would suggest. Which option describes a likely cause?(1 point)

The thermometer being used might need to be recalibrated.

The experimental setup might be too well insulated, causing higher temperatures.

The heat from the liquids might be escaping too easily.

The amount of liquid being tested might be insufficient.

To determine the likely cause of the consistently higher boiling points of the liquids being studied, we need to consider the factors that can affect the boiling point measurement. Let's analyze the options:

1. The thermometer being used might need to be recalibrated: This is a possible cause. If the thermometer is not accurately measuring the temperature, it could lead to incorrect boiling point readings.

2. The experimental setup might be too well insulated, causing higher temperatures: This option suggests that the experimental setup is trapping heat excessively, potentially leading to higher temperatures. However, it doesn't explain why the boiling points are consistently higher than expected.

3. The heat from the liquids might be escaping too easily: This option suggests that the heat energy from the liquids is dissipating too quickly, which would result in lower temperatures rather than higher boiling points.

4. The amount of liquid being tested might be insufficient: Insufficient liquid quantity is unlikely to cause consistently higher boiling points. It would generally result in quicker boiling due to the lower heat capacity of the small liquid volume.

Based on the information provided, option 1 appears to be the most likely cause. To confirm, the student should ensure that the thermometer is properly calibrated before continuing the experiment.
